In this thought-provoking episode, we delve into the intriguing discussion sparked by Alex O'Connor's recent appearance on Rainn Wilson's podcast, Soul Boom. Alex addresses the differing resurrection accounts of Jesus as depicted in the New Testament books of Matthew, Mark, Luke, and John. This episode closely examines the apparent contradictions between these gospels and the underlying reasons for their variances.
The conversation touches upon the importance of examining text with an open mind while acknowledging each gospel writer's distinct purpose. We explore Luke's historical approach in his gospel and Acts, juxtaposed against the other gospels, and the significance of the 40-day timeline post-resurrection. Through this lens, we challenge the notion of collusion among gospel writers and discuss what these differences reveal about the authenticity of the events or possible embellishments over time.
